Dye Rotor Power Button LED doesn't work anymore?

The LED on my rotor quit lighting up. how can this be fixed?

By replacing the led on the board. which required soldering and such, Or by buying a new board. If it's not a bother dont change it.

take out your batteries and take off your battery pack, it should be inside the gear box..make sure it didnt come loose, it may still be on, but it could have wiggled itself out a little bit and isnt snug anymore
